#d1f177 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1f177 is composed of 82% red, 94.5%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 75.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#d1f177 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ffee with #a3e300.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d1f177 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1f177 has RGB values of R:209, G:241,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 13758839.

Shades and Tints of #d1f177
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050601 is the darkest color, while #fbfef3 is the lightest one.
